Why is Product Marketing Important?

Product marketing plays a pivotal role in a product’s success by:

  • Building Brand Awareness: Generating excitement and buzz around your product before and after launch.
  • Educating the Market: Communicating the product’s value proposition and benefits to your target audience.
  • Positioning Your Product: Differentiating your product from competitors and establishing its unique value.
  • Driving User Adoption: Encouraging users to try, understand, and ultimately become loyal users of your product.

Crafting Your Product’s Narrative

A captivating product story is the foundation of effective product marketing. Here’s what it entails:

  • Understanding Your Audience: Who are you trying to reach? What are their needs, pain points, and aspirations?
  • Defining Your Value Proposition: What problem does your product solve? What makes it unique and beneficial?
  • Developing a Messaging Framework: Craft clear, concise messaging that resonates with your audience and highlights your product’s value.
  • Creating Compelling Content: Develop engaging content (blogs, videos, social media posts) that educates and excites your audience about your product.

The Art of Storytelling

Product marketing goes beyond just listing features. It’s about weaving a narrative that connects with your audience on an emotional level. Here are some tips for impactful storytelling:

  • Focus on the Benefits: People care about how your product will improve their lives. Focus on the benefits it provides, not just the features.
  • Use Real-World Examples: Showcase how your product solves real problems for real people.
  • Evoke Emotion: Tap into the emotions of your audience to create a lasting impression.
  • Be Authentic & Transparent: Build trust with your audience by being genuine and transparent in your communications.
